Abstract
Objective:To investigate expressions of Th17 cell in rat model of pulmonary fibrosis(PF).Methods:Totally 54 SD rats were randomly divided into 3 groups:control group(N group,n=18),PF model group(B group,n=18)and dexmethasone treated group(D group).B and D groups were established by a single intra-tracheal injection of 5 mg/kg of bleomycin.N group received intra-tracheal instillation of saline instead.The next day D group was injected with dexamethasone(3 mg/kg)intraperitoneally every other day while N and B groups were injected with saline.Rats were sacrificed at the 7th,14 th,28th d after modeling in batch.Lung tissues were restored to analyze the pathological changes with HE staining and levels of hydroxyproline(HYP)in pulmonary tissues were determined. Proportion of CD4 + IL-17 + Th17 cells in the lung was evaluated by flow cytometry.Levels of serum interleukin-17(IL-17)were measured by ELISA.Results:①In B group,biopsy of pulmonary tissues showed the dynamic process of change from pulmonary alveolitis to PF gradually.Levels of HYP in pulmonary tissues were higher in B group(the highest on the 28th d)than in N and D groups(P 0.05).②Th17 cell was lowly expressed in N group.Expressions of Th17 cell in pulmonary tissues and serum IL-17 were significantly higher in B and D groups than in N group at all time points(P0.05),being most obviously at the 7th d.Conclusions:PF is developed by inflammatory damage and repair and has different pathological characteristics at different time points.Increased expressions of Th17 cell in pulmonary tissues of PF rats and serum IL-17 are associated with pulmonary inflammation and PF.
